Type
ORACLE
Validation date
2024-12-20 12:45: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.02164,
    "usd": 0.02249
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000160479DD06EFCC508773B69087F90A31D451D5CE6C68ACF03461787DAFB527BF6

Previous signature

4C4D62EE0C2EC5AB06E0ABE8952021EE387F7BF31FAB1E87B1327E941621E0BAC769EBCE21649F93AE92D771C504428077D341528AAF057C9F4E437F90ED4406

Origin signature

3046022100DDD5F5FF12476A7CF30AEC92DE46DB7EF0F3046C42136CE8AE14EDCD237F7AB5022100BF801D1ED1AEBB7E24E75FFAFC57CEED7F07723056C9D132FFFB7EEFDC2D4D7A

Proof of work

01010484B78F4110D8E9D6FBEC72759895CC9D4532177314FBAA8B07BC525FC1AF48F150EFBF104B1819106B8E3563CD0E1FAAE5325F8FCFE58FF744C35F47669D2704

Proof of integrity

0038754C979DA108355BF6E107342560D63B724E4A0353FBFF9667AA3ED772FEC1

Coordinator signature

0313A983147EF57E23BED09C2DB2D37FB3D34102F01479BFB668B5A6EB9D63F2E80653EDC7592DE4F8EF2B4B3A0770B284F409624E2B471DF2588F469ED0EB04

Validator #1 public key

00013D16BDF02C72DB6831A1EB14200C6D5427B4303351645BDFFC9B132DFE3A53FC

Validator #1 signature

7B0BDC6FCC97FF9D1E967AD6D65D6953ED9491D23EFDCBAD7CCFF20DD8E133FC6EB7BB182368615CCAE29A61C92938DFEA0B2159A0B1A2B98AFFBA20017B200A

Validator #2 public key

00013979F182FBF100A7D850091072443374862E8A007B24B5E14A1405B1F3B1F406

Validator #2 signature

BD3892D79CAAB33034459175E1E129DD4B90A397C38796FB2328C437AF705ABA5E7332E4ED8118DB8A50017BE0C4F0A16556B20925103E9902AC41F68248720C